Projects for Key Research Themes
WKC convened an expert meeting in 2018 to address the urgent need for Health EDRM research to develop evidence-based policies, programmes and practices. Four research themes were identified to inform effective all-hazards health emergency prevention, preparedness, response and recovery [1].
Long-term Psychosocial Impact of Natural Disasters on Survivors in Japan
Over the past few decades, the frequency and severity of natural disasters have increased. Growing population, unplanned urbanization, ageing and related demographic trends have contributed to this change. The 3rd UN World Conference for Disaster Risk Reduction, Sendai Framework for Disaster Risk Reduction 2015-2025 (SFDRR), highlights the fundamental role of health in disaster risk management (DRM) and emphasizes the need for scientific evidence in this area. In practice, the majority of attention to DRM has focused on preparedness and response.
